Spotted drift on the Thistledown orphaned-resource sweeper again — staging is running a stricter grace period than what's in the repo, so it nuked two perfectly healthy test volumes on Tuesday. This PR brings the checked-in config back in line with what's actually deployed. For the record, the intended canonical values are these.

deployment values, yadug-bawif:
[framir]
team = pelox
access_code = ac_a38ab2
owner = tamion.julael
host = framir.tolvaqlabs.test
port = 11211
peer = tammir.zemvargrid.local
salt = 2215ef03
pin = 1541

## Handover: FX Rounding — Pennygrove

Short version: conversions were rounding per line item, then summing — totals drifted by a cent or two on large invoices. Fix in v3.1 sums in minor units first, rounds once. Don't touch the banker's-rounding flag; downstream reconciliation at Ledgewick depends on it. Tests in `fx_round_spec` cover the edge cases — add there, not in the integration suite. Remaining task: backfill corrected totals for March. The converter service currently runs with these configuration values.

deployment values, yadup-kadug:
[sorys]
port = 5672
team = noveth
host = sorys.orvexcorp.example
region = south-4
access_code = ac_deddc1
timeout_ms = 1500

# Break-Glass: Catalog Cache Invalidation

Scope: the Pinrow product catalog at Veldstone Retail. If stale prices persist after a purge and the Hollowmere invalidation queue is wedged, use break-glass to flush the edge tier directly. Contractors: get verbal sign-off from the catalog lead first. Steps: open the Hollowmere admin shell, select emergency-flush, confirm the tenant, and run it once — repeated flushes thrash the origin. Access is logged and expires after 20 minutes. Unseal the admin shell with the passphrase below.

recovery phrase for kahop-tajog: istix-casvan